Improving the performance parameters of a halide thin-film perovskite solar cell using different shape plasmonic nanoparticles

Within the current investigation, the plasmonic nanoparticles were utilized for improvement the photocurrent of an organic-inorganic hybrid crystalline-based CH3NH3PbX3 perovskite solar cell. The perovskite solar cells have the fastest growing rate of conversion efficiency among solar cells. Here, it was shown that the absorption spectra of a perovskite solar cell can be increased by using a different shape plasmonic nanoparticles. The results show that the photocurrent was increased compared to the reference cell form 17.7mA/cm2 to 20.2mA/cm2, 21.5mA/cm2 and 23mA/cm2for a cell with spherical, cylindrical and cubic nanoparticles, respectively.
